  • How is the weather in Desert Hot Springs?

    Desert Hot Springs experiences mild winters near 46–67°F (8–20°C), while summers are warm with highs around 87–89°F (31–32°C) and minimal rain. Pack light layers, sun protection, and comfortable attire for outdoor activities.

  • What is Desert Hot Springs known for?

    Desert Hot Springs is known for its naturally heated mineral springs, tranquil spa culture, and panoramic desert landscapes. The area’s wellness reputation draws many visitors seeking relaxation.

  • When is the best time to visit Desert Hot Springs?

    Spring and autumn are often recommended for visiting Desert Hot Springs, with comfortable temperatures and clearer skies. Many travelers enjoy outdoor pools and scenic walks during these milder months.
